It's hard to turn regular season success into postseason wins, a fact Gulf Coast can now relate to. They lost 3-0 to the Riverdale Raiders on Wednesday.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est defeat the Sharks have suffered since September 3rd.

While Gulf Coast was not able to make it on the board, they still kept things close, especially in the second set.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-15, 25-22, 25-14.

Leading Riverdale to victory were Emily Grant and Natalie Grant. Emily had nine digs and 16 assists, while Natalie had ten digs. Emily is on a roll when it comes to assists, as she's now posted 12 or more in the last six games she's played dating back to last season.

Gulf Coast has been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five games, which put a noticeable dent in their 10-13 record this season. As for Riverdale, the victory (which was their fourth in a row) raised their record to 12-8.
